The Anatomy of a Car Battery
A car battery is a rechargeable battery that stores chemical energy in the form of lead plates and sulfuric acid. It’s designed to supply power to the vehicle’s electrical systems, including the starter motor, lights, and accessories. A typical car battery consists of six cells, each producing 2.1 volts, resulting in a total voltage of 12.6 volts.
- The battery’s electrolyte is a sulfuric acid solution that facilitates chemical reactions between the lead plates, allowing the battery to charge and discharge.
- The battery’s terminals, usually made of copper or lead, connect the positive and negative plates to the vehicle’s electrical system.
Charging Basics: How it Works
When a car is running, the alternator converts mechanical energy from the engine into electrical energy, which is then used to charge the battery. The charging process involves the alternator forcing a flow of electrical current into the battery, reversing the chemical reactions that occur during discharge. This process replenishes the battery’s energy, ensuring it remains healthy and functional.

Choosing the Right Charging Method
The type of charging method you use can significantly impact the overall efficiency and effectiveness of the charging process. For instance, using a trickle charger can be beneficial for maintaining a battery’s charge over an extended period, whereas a boost charger is ideal for quickly replenishing a drained battery. When choosing a charging method, consider the type of battery you have, the amount of time you have to charge, and the level of power required.
- Consider investing in a smart charger that can automatically adjust its output to match the battery’s state of charge, ensuring optimal charging efficiency.
- Avoid using high-powered chargers, as they can cause damage to the battery or other electrical components in your vehicle.

How Does a Car Battery Recharger Compare to a Jump Starter?
A car battery recharger and a jump starter serve different purposes. A jump starter is designed to provide a quick burst of energy to start a car, while a recharger is designed to provide a slow and steady flow of electricity to maintain the battery’s charge. A jump starter is typically more expensive and less convenient to use than a recharger, but it’s essential for emergency situations where you need to start your car quickly.
